LTC3765  
Active Clamp Forward  
Controller and Gate Driver  
FEATURES  
DESCRIPTION  
The LTC®3765 is a start-up controller and gate driver for  
use in a self-starting secondary-side control forward con-  
verter. When combined with the LTC3766 secondary-side  
synchronousforwardcontroller,acompleteisolatedpower  
supply is created using a minimum of discrete parts. A  
proprietary scheme is used to multiplex gate drive signals  
and bias power across the isolation barrier through a  
small pulse transformer. The LTC3765 contains an on-  
chip bridge rectifier that extracts gate drive bias power  
from this pulse transformer, eliminating the need for a  
separate bias supply. A precision undervoltage lockout  
circuit and linear regulator controller ensure a quick and  
well-controlled start-up.

TheLTC3765includesanactiveclampoutputfordrivingan  
external PMOS, as well as an adjustable delay to optimize  
efficiency. The active clamp architecture reduces voltage  
stress on the main power switch, and provides the highest  
possible efficiency. Overcurrent protection and the Direct  
Flux Limit guarantee no transformer saturation without  
compromising transient response.
